What Are Gold Bonds?
Gold bonds are financial instruments that allow you to invest in gold without holding the physical metal. Instead of buying gold coins or bars, you purchase a bond whose value is linked to the prevailing market price of gold. These bonds are issued and regulated by recognised authorities, which adds a layer of credibility and security to your investment. In India, Sovereign Gold Bonds are issued under the authority of the Reserve Bank of India on behalf of the Government of India, while digital gold products are often backed by physical gold stored in secured vaults by entities like MMTC-PAMP and are subject to oversight guidelines.
Why Consider Gold Bonds Over Physical Gold?
Physical gold comes with challenges such as storage risk, making charges, and concerns about purity. Gold bonds address many of these concerns. When you invest in gold bonds online, you do not need to worry about storing the metal safely or verifying its purity. The value of your investment moves in line with gold prices, and you avoid the overhead costs associated with physical ownership. Additionally, gold bonds can offer periodic interest income in some formats, making them a more structured investment compared to simply buying and holding physical gold.
Types of Gold Bond Investments Available in India
In India, investors broadly have two popular routes when it comes to gold bond-style investments. The first is Sovereign Gold Bonds, which are government-backed securities linked to the domestic price of gold. These have a defined tenure and offer periodic interest payments over and above any capital appreciation tied to gold prices. The second route is digital gold, where you can buy gold in very small denominations online, and the equivalent quantity of physical gold is stored securely on your behalf. How To Invest In Gold Bonds Online: Step-By-Step
Investing in gold bonds online is a straightforward process. Here is how you can approach it.

The second step is to complete your KYC. Like any financial investment in India, you will need to complete your Know Your Customer verification. This typically involves submitting identity and address proof documents. Most online platforms allow you to complete KYC digitally within minutes.
The third step is to decide your investment amount. One of the biggest advantages of investing in gold bonds or digital gold online is that you can start with a small amount. You do not need to commit a large sum upfront, which makes it accessible to a wider range of investors.
The fourth step is to make the payment. Once your account is set up and verified, you can proceed to invest using net banking, UPI, or debit card. The transaction is usually processed instantly, and your investment is reflected in your account without delay.
The fifth step is to monitor and manage your investment. After purchasing, you can track the value of your holding through the platform's dashboard. You can also choose to sell your gold bonds or digital gold units when prices are favourable, all from within the app or website.
Key Factors To Evaluate Before Investing
Before committing your money, there are several qualitative aspects worth considering. Credibility of the platform is paramount. Ensure that the platform you choose is regulated or partnered with recognised entities under SEBI or other relevant regulatory frameworks. Liquidity is another consideration. Some gold bonds come with lock-in periods, while digital gold platforms often offer greater flexibility to buy and sell. Storage and insurance are also important. When opting for digital gold, confirm that the underlying physical gold is stored in insured, certified vaults. Finally, understand the fee structure. Different platforms may charge spreads or transaction fees, which can affect your effective investment value over time.

Gold Bonds and Portfolio Diversification
Financial advisors often recommend diversifying investments across asset classes to manage risk. Gold has historically shown low correlation with equity markets, meaning it does not always move in the same direction as stocks. By including gold bonds or digital gold in your portfolio, you can potentially reduce overall volatility. However, it is important to treat gold as one component of a broader investment strategy rather than a standalone solution. Aligning your gold investments with your financial goals, time horizon, and risk appetite is essential.
